#eed428 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#eed428 is composed of 93.3% red, 83.1%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10.9% magenta, 83.2%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 52.1 degrees, a saturation of 85.3% and a lightness of 54.5%. #eed428 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ff50 with #dda900.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c33.

Shades and Tints of #eed428

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030300 is the darkest color, while #fefcf0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#eed428

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c8c8a is the less saturated color, while #f7db1f is the most saturated one.
